از مدیریت بهبود یافته هویت در ASP.NET Core برای اجرای احراز هویت مبتنی بر هویت برای حداقل APIها به سرعت، آسان و با کد کمتر بهره ببرید.
مایکروسافت دات نت
آخرین پیشنمایش دات نت ۹، بهبودهای طرحبندی کد را برای کامپایلر RyuJIT، بهبودهای ذخیرهسازی حافظه پنهان در هسته ASP.NET، ابزار Metrics Gauge و بسیاری موارد دیگر به ارمغان میآورد.
آخرین بهروزرسانی پشته آماده ابری مایکروسافت برای ساخت برنامههای کاربردی توزیع شده، توانایی راهاندازی سرویسهای مبتنی بر پایتون را نیز اضافه میکند.
ویژگی ها و پارامترهای جزئی نیز در به روز رسانی زبان برنامه ریزی شده برجسته شده اند.
نحوه پیادهسازی احراز هویت اولیه رمز عبور برای یک API حداقل در ASP.NET Core با استفاده از یک کنترلکننده احراز هویت سفارشی که اعتبار کاربر را در برابر پایگاه داده تأیید میکند.
TouchBehavior توانایی تعامل با عناصر بصری در برنامههای NET را بر اساس لمس، کلیکهای ماوس و رویدادهای شناور فراهم میکند.
از قابلیت انعطاف پذیری اتصال در EF Core برای شناسایی خطاها و دستورات مجدد استفاده کنید و برنامه ASP.NET Core خود را برای غلبه بر خطاهای گذرا فعال کنید.
ابزار ارزیابی کد، کد منبع شما را اسکن میکند و مشکلات احتمالی را شناسایی میکند که باید هنگام ارتقا بین نسخههای NET. یا .NET Core برطرف شوند.
کلاس SearchValues جدید از بردارسازی و شتاب سخت افزاری برای سرعت بخشیدن به جستجوهای مکرر در NET 8 بهره می برد.
کلاس SearchValues جدید از بردارسازی و شتاب سخت افزاری برای سرعت بخشیدن به جستجوهای مکرر در NET 8 بهره می برد.
وقت آن است که از پسوردها دور شوید. مایکروسافت ابزارهایی برای کمک به شما در شروع کار دارد.
جانشین مایکروسافت سیلورلایت منبع باز به توسعه دهندگان این امکان را می دهد که رابط های وب تعاملی غنی با دات نت، سی شارپ، XAML، و اکنون، F# بسازند.
AutoMapper زندگی را آسان می کند، اما محدودیت هایی دارد. یاد بگیرید که چگونه یک نگاشت سفارشی را برای مدیریت ساختارهای داده پیچیده یا انواع ناسازگار پیاده سازی کنید.
آمازون نوشتن توابع Lambda را در سی شارپ با ویژگی هایی مانند حاشیه نویسی Lambda ساده می کند، که از ژنراتورهای منبع C# برای تولید کد از مسیر REST API استفاده می کند. پشتیبانی از دات نت ۸ به زودی ارائه می شود.
Azure Key Vault مکانی امن و مطمئن برای ذخیره نشانهها، کلیدها، گذرواژهها، گواهیها و سایر دادههای حساس مورد استفاده در برنامههای NET Core شما است. در اینجا نحوه کار با آن در سی شارپ آمده است.
از احراز هویت کلید API برای کنترل دسترسی برنامه ها و خدمات به API های وب خود در ASP.NET Core استفاده کنید.
شما چندین راه مختلف برای ذخیره و بازیابی داده ها بین درخواست ها در برنامه های ASP.NET Core MVC دارید. در اینجا نحوه استفاده از آنها آورده شده است.
از SendGrid برای ادغام ایمیل قابل اعتماد و مقیاس پذیر در برنامه های ASP.NET Core خود استفاده کنید. در اینجا نحوه
از مزیت is و به عنوان اپراتور در سی شارپ برای انجام عملیات ریخته گری زیبا و نوشتن کدی که به خوبی ساختار یافته، مختصر و قابل نگهداری است استفاده کنید.
از میانافزار رفع فشردهسازی درخواست در ASP.NET Core 7 استفاده کنید تا نقاط پایانی API خود را قادر به پذیرش درخواستهایی که حاوی محتوای فشردهشده هستند، داشته باشید.